# QNAP Hybrid Backup Sync 3 With Wasabi

[QNAP Hybrid Backup Sync 3 (HBS 3)](https://www.qnap.com/en/software/hybrid-backup-sync) has been validated for use with Wasabi. For information on how HBS 3 works with Wasabi, refer to [QNAP](https://wasabi.com/qnap). Follow the steps below to configure Wasabi as a backup destination and to restore data from Wasabi.

> The data restoration process is handled by your specific backup software application. As there are many potential variables that will affect your unique environment, it is strongly recommended that you seek the guidance of your backup software's technical support team in the event that you encounter difficulty or have application-specific inquiries.

### **Prerequisites**

- Active Wasabi Cloud Storage account (see [Create a Wasabi Account](https://wasabi.com/sign-up)).
- Wasabi bucket. Using Object Lock on your bucket is highly recommended from a security perspective so your data will be immutable. For more information, review [Working With Buckets and Objects](https://docs.wasabi.com/docs/working-with-buckets-and-objects). This guide covers creating the bucket directly from within HBS 3.
- Access Key and Secret Key. For more information, review [Creating a User Account and Access Key](https://docs.wasabi.com/docs/creating-a-user-account-and-access-key).
- QNAP NAS with [HBS 3 Hybrid Backup Sync](https://www.qnap.com/en/app_center/) installed and licensed. This solution was tested with HBS 3 version 26.3.0.226 and QuTScloud version c5.2.4.3041.

## Configuring a Wasabi Storage Space

Before creating a backup job, connect your Wasabi account to HBS 3 by adding it as a Storage Space. A Storage Space stores your Wasabi credentials and can be reused across multiple backup jobs.

1. Open **HBS 3 Hybrid Backup Sync** from the QNAP NAS console.

![lmqk](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-e91bayti.png)

1. In the left navigation panel, click **Storage Spaces**.

![lnaf](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-fkp397g5.png)

1. Click **Create**.

![lnhp](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-c2ugnfeu.png)

1. In the Filter field, type Wasabi. Select the **Wasabi** tile.

![lnnz](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-w1u794qg.png)

1. In the Create a Storage Space dialog, enter the following information. Click **Create**.

- Name—A friendly name for this storage space (for example, "Wasabi 1").
- Access key—Your Wasabi Access Key.
- Secret key—Your Wasabi Secret Key.

![lofp](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-ttdvuhpj.png)

1. The new storage space appears in the Storage Spaces list with a green checkmark, confirming a successful connection to Wasabi.

![lpih](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-bwp38z75.png)

## Backing Up to Wasabi

1. In the navigation panel, click **Backup & Restore**. Click **Back Up Now** drop-down arrow.

![lqih](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-frk36nqx.png)

1. Select **New backup job**.

![lqtv](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-zfnm6r7g.png)

1. In the Create a Backup Job wizard, under Select the source folders, expand your NAS in the folder tree and check the folders you want to back up. Click **Next**.

![ltyl](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-m3juerh8.png)

1. Under Select the destination storage space, type Wasabi in the Filter field. Select the **Wasabi** tile. Select your Wasabi storage space from the list. Click **Select**.

![luso](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-zhe4sh1z.png)

1. Click **+ New Bucket** to create a new Wasabi bucket.

![lvhj](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-k4e8thve.png)

1. In the Create a New Bucket dialog, enter a Bucket name, and select the Region name. Check **Enable Object Lock** (this is highly recommended to help prevent accidental or malicious data deletion). Click **Create**.

![lvvh](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-j9d4m9u0.png)

> This configuration example discusses the use of Wasabi’s us-east-1 storage region. Use the region your bucket is located in or that you wish your bucket to be created in. For a list of regions, see [Available Storage Regions](https://docs.wasabi.com/docs/en/where-is-my-data-stored-and-how-are-wasabis-storage-regions-secured?highlight=regions#available-storage-regions).

1. The new bucket is selected automatically. The message **This bucket supports Object Lock** is shown below the bucket name. Click **Select**.

![lwla](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-8de7znh9.png)

1. Under Select the destination folder, select the bucket (or a subfolder within it) as the destination. Click **OK**.

![mdla](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-kaqg9sb8.png)

1. Review the job name and source/destination summary. Click **Next.**

![medt](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-36jnvo6f.png)

1. Select **Scheduler** and click **+** to add a schedule. Click **Next**.

![meov](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-mtfo1b5p.png)

1. Select the appropriate backup frequency, set your preferred Start time. Click **OK**. In our example we selected **Daily** at midnight (00:00).

![mfid](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-xvz0ow2d.png)

1. The configured schedule appears in the Schedules list. Check **Back Up Now** to run the first backup immediately when the job is created. Click **Next**.

![mgrr](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-pqdv8et3.png)

1. On the Rules tab, review the filter and advanced settings. Click **Policies.** ![](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-xg14m7ru.png)
2. Select the checkbox to **Override Object Lock default settings** (if using Object Lock). Adjust the settings to match your requirements. Click **Next**.

![](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-uudjltjq.png)

1. On the **Summary** tab, confirm all job settings. Click **Create**.

![mhwx](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-zla52q6x.png)

1. The backup job runs immediately. When complete, the job status shows **Success** along with the date and time of the backup and the next scheduled run. Click **Check Data Integrity**.

![mipa](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-4udxza5l.png)

1. Select **Quick Check**. HBS 3 will verify the backup files in Wasabi and report the result.

![mjcb](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-xsauvoq4.png)

![mjti](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-khax0tty.png)

## Restoring From Wasabi Backups

In the event that you need to restore data from a Wasabi backup, follow the steps below.

1. In HBS 3, click **Backup & Restore** in the left navigation panel. Click **Create** drop-down arrow and select **Restore job**.

![mkzx](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-8bhcaw7h.png)

1. In the Create a Restore Job wizard, type Wasabi in the Filter field. Select the **Wasabi** tile, then select your Wasabi storage space. Click **Select**.

![](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-aypu7lkz.png)

1. Select your backup bucket from the Bucket name drop-down. Click **Select**.

![mmxn](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-jln87hnd.png)

1. Select the backup job from the source drop-down and set the destination to **Original location** (or choose an alternative). Click **+** next to Select source to choose the backup version and folders to restore.

![mpec](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-hovc8b7j.png)

1. A timeline shows all available backup versions. Select the version you want to restore. On the right, check the folders or files to restore. Click **OK**.

![mpyi](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-p3v37eu3.png)

1. Review the Conflict policy. Click **Next**.

![mqko](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-1jck10ks.png)

1. On the Schedule tab, select **No schedule** and check **Restore Now** to begin the restore. Click **Next**.

![mqud](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-mp6fpeez.png)

1. On the Rules tab, review policy settings. Click **Next**.

![mrfx](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-qozekrob.png)

1. On the Summary tab, confirm all restore job settings. Click **Restore**.

![mrlm](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-avldbe63.png)

1. The restore job will run. When complete, the status shows **Success**.

![mrxu](https://cdn.document360.io/bef0a1ea-7768-4d5a-b520-c4fe2f7fafad/Images/Documentation/qnap-hybrid-backup-sync-3-with-wasabi-image-4ftoavff.png)
